A wonderful and satisfying conclusion!

It's always nice to see Toshio show genuine concern for Yuu. As much of a dick he can be, it's also been clear Yuu is the most important person in his life.

I guess this series could've been a bit more mature and there were some missed opportunities story-wise but I have no qualms about it being episodic, especially since it didn't follow an established formula -- a few episodes didn't even feature Mami at all.

One thing that did bug me though was hearing a completely new song during Mami's farewell concert. I love the 4-5 Mami songs they repeat throughout the series but as an idol anime meant to promote Takako Ohta's career, this show really should've had more music. I wish it had been more like Jem & the Holograms in that way.

It's also unfortunate we never got to see Megumi Ayase and Mami really "make-up", it would've been nice for her to know Yuu's secret.

Edit: It annoyed me that they tried to add secret identity drama and a narrative about Yuu wanting to stay as Mami in the final few episodes, but the pay-off of Yuu definitively declaring that she is herself and Mami is Mami was nice and actually worked pretty well.
